Output 76aa5e05ded95df8f2a52da21fbce9199bfd1d7bc2cec2c1d0d1b84fb8fa22e7:0

value
2528669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ca8e499e0c8e851535b7db7d5ff8e80091ce90 OP_EQUAL
address
39L4fHnJM3hwhDSEuyxVATDGrPyMxjBmDy
transaction
76aa5e05ded95df8f2a52da21fbce9199bfd1d7bc2cec2c1d0d1b84fb8fa22e7
confirmations
388803
spent
true